Pre-Columbian Peru, Moche III period, 300-400 AD
Terracotta, metal oxides and slip
H. 12 cm
Inscription under the base R-4384
Provenance: Private collection, Versailles
Charming statuette called muneca, depicting a standing male figure, arms folded on the chest, wearing a two-pointed cap and earrings. The figurine has been struck on the back, where a small hole appears, and the missing shard is mobile inside the object. This gesture corresponds to a ritual desecration to avoid the reuse of the object.
